Minitab Graphs Pdf Probability Distribution Scatter Plot The probability density function (pdf) of a random variable, x, allows you to calculate the probability of an event, as follows: for continuous distributions, the probability that x has values in an interval (a, b) is precisely the area under its pdf in the interval (a, b). Minitab can be used to find the appropriate probability distribution of your data. you may use the individual distribution identification in minitab to confirm that a particular distribution best fits your current data.

Use probability distributions to calculate the values of a probability density function (pdf), cumulative distribution function (cdf), or inverse cumulative distribution function (icdf) for many different data distributions. Choose calc > probability distributions, select the distribution, then enter the parameters. It explains how to use minitab's probability distribution function to calculate the probability of a specific number of successes or cumulative probabilities. it also describes how to generate random binomial data and perform descriptive statistics to view the distribution as a histogram. Choose graph > probability distribution plot, select the graph that you want to create, then select the distribution and enter the parameters.
